Matthew 8-9 Jesus spends the first day healing the leper, the centurion’s servant and Peters motherin- law, and all who were brought to Him that evening. After He healed all those who were there, Jesus and the twelve climbed into a boat and start to the other side of the lake. Jesus, being tired from ministry got in the bottom of the boat and fell asleep. The storm tossed the boat and scared the disciples so they went and woke Jesus up for help. Jesus rebuked the wind and waves and the sea was clam again. Then next morning they arrived on the other side of the lake and meet two men coming out of the tombs and Jesus casting out the demons commanded them to go into the swine nearby. The swine went crazy and ran off the steep place and drown in the water. The people in the city were upset about losing their herd and asked Jesus to leave. The took the boat back across the lake and when they arrived, a paralytic was there waiting to be healed. The scribes there accused Him of blasphemy even though the paralyzed man was able to walk. Jesus was criticized for eating with the sinners who need to hear the good news of the gospel. As he headed to pray for Jairus’s daughter, a woman with an issue of blood for 12 years crawled to touch the hem of His garment and received her healing. They mourners and others present at Jairus’ house ridiculed Jesus when He told them that the dead girl was sleeping. After sending them out of the room, Jesus brought her back to life. As Jesus left Jairus; house, two blind men, men that could not see followed Him and began to cry out asking Jesus to have mercy on them. Jesus turned into their house and simply asked them “Do you believe that I am able to do this?” When they answered yes, Jesus touched their eyes and they were opened. Jesus interacted with all these different people in a two-day period, getting a plethora of response. Some received their healing or brought others to healed, some asked Him to leave because it affected their finances, all the religious leaders criticized the people Jesus hung out with, questioned why they did not fast, and mocked Him when He was ready to heal, knowing full well the scriptures pertaining to the Messiah and His ministry.
